Past Indefinite Tense


Syntax (Structure)


Active Voice

                    Subject+ verb 2nd form + object.

 

Passive Voice

                 Subject+ H/V (was + were) + verb 3rd form + by + object.

 

Implementing (Examples)

Positive Sentences

(1) A/V: We changed our clothes.

     P/V: Our clothes were changed by us.

(2) A/V: You sang a song.

     P/V: A song was sung by you.

(3) A/V: They brought the food from market.

     P/V: The food was brought from market by them.

(4) A/V: She listened the news about Junaid Jamshid.

    P/V: The news was listened by her about Junaid Jamshid Sahib.

(5) A/V: He ate the bread with butter.

     P/V: The bread was eaten by him with butter.

(6) A/V: I squeezed my clothes.

     P/V: My clothes were squeezed by me.

(7) A/V: Bilal played cricket with friends.

     PlV: Cricket were played by Bilal with friends.

 

Syntax (Structure) Negative

Formula

A/V: Subject + did not + verb 1st form + object.

 

Formula

P/V:  Subject+ (was, were) + not + verb 3rd form + by + object.

 

Examples

(1) A/V: They did not make a noise.

 P/V: A noise was not made by them.

(2) A/V: We did not collect the papers.

     P/V: A paper were not collected by us.

(3) A/V: She did not take the computer classes.

     P/V: The computer classes were not taken by her.

(4) A/V: He did not pluck the flowers.

      P/V: The flowers were not plucked by him.

(5) A/V: You did not clean your room.

      P/V: Your room was not cleaned by you.

(6) A/V: I did not charge my clothes.

      P/V: My clothes were not changed by me.

(7) A/V: Shazia and Maria did not sing a song.

      P/V: A song was not sung by Shazia and Maria.

 

Syntax (Structure) Interrogative


Formula

         A/V:  Did + subject + verb 1st form + object?

 

Formula

         P/V: Was/were+ subject + verb 3rd  form + by + object?

 

Examples

(1) A/V: Did we finish our work?

       P/V: Was our work finished by us?

(2) A/V: Did she catch the ball?

      P/V:  Was the ball caught by her?

(3) A/V: Did he bring the water from spring?

      P/V: Was the water brought by him from spring?

(4) A/V: Did they dig their land?

     P/v: Was their land dig by them?

(5) A/V: Did you break the mirror?

       P/V: Was the mirror broken by you?

(6) A/V: Did I get 1st position?

 P/V: Was the 1st position got by me?

(7) A/V: Did the children make a noise?

      P/V: Was noise made by children?
